More than a dozen fireman tackled a raging fire which broke out at an industrial estate in Hopton.
Four fire engines rushed to Hopton Timber Estate today when a compressor caught fire near a large wooden building.
Crews from Great Yarmouth, Gorleston, Acle and Lowestoft North and South stations were called to the incident on Hall Road at 8.15am.
The blaze was contained and the scene made safe by 9.11am.
An ambulance crew also attended, but there were no casualties.
